My 5 Favorite Films Since 2000


Sorry for the 11 days between posts.  I've been busy: I spent four days backpacking the Appalachian Trail, celebrated my grandmother's 80th birthday and my niece's 4th birthday on consecutive days, and was at the beach for the last three days.  Having said that, while hiking over 42 miles on the AT, my two buddies and I passed the time with silly lists and games.  During one stretch, each of us listed our five favorite films since the year 2000.  Here is my list, in no particular order:

  1. Winter's Bone
  2. No Country For Old Men
  3. There Will Be Blood
  4. Anchorman
  5. Inglorious Basterds


I am sure I am forgetting about a few movies that I really enjoyed over the last 11 years, but I am satisfied with this list at the moment.  Others that come to mind: Mystic River, The Departed, Midnight in Paris (if you haven't seen this movie yet, sprint to a movie theater right now), The Social Network (for the score more than anything), The King's Speech, The Pianist, House of Sand And Fog, Million Dollar Baby, Good Night and Good Luck, Match Point, Up in the Air and Doubt.
